#dbcb53 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dbcb53 is composed of 85.9% red, 79.6%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.3% magenta, 62.1%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 52.9 degrees, a saturation of 65.4% and a lightness of 59.2%. #dbcb53 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a6 with #b79700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#dbcb53

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060601 is the darkest color, while #fdfcf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dbcb53

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9a93 is the less saturated color, while #fbe333 is the most saturated one.
